India all set to give Sachin a dream farewell

India all set to give Sachin a dream farewell

India will take on the West Indies in the second Test at the Wankhede Stadium, Mumbai tomorrow with all eyes on Sachin Tendulkar as he will play his last test match. India seems confident enough after a comfortable win over West Indies in last match at Eden Gardens, Kolkata and will be looking to repeat the same. West Indies on the other side will surely be disappointed by their performance and will be expecting their batsman to play well. Although Sachin Tendulkar will be the center of attention for the whole test, West Indies will try their best to spoil Sachin’s dream farewell. Dhoni even announced Sachin to lead the side and appointed him the captain for the last match. While Tendulkar is set for 200 Tests, Chanderpaul will also be playing his 150th Test. It seems there will be no change in Indian side. One the other hand, West Indies may go with one extra batsman as batting was mainly responsible for their defeat in last test match. The wicket of Wankhede Stadium, Mumbai seems good enough for batting and everyone will be pleased if Sachin gets a ton there. Wankhede pitch will stay firmer in last days and will favour batsman to some extent. Weather will remain fine but there are few chances of unseasonal rains.  Tendulkar’s retirement will be the limelight for the match but we all want it to finish on a good note. Although he’ll say goodbye to cricket after the match but will surely remain in the heart of millions.
